I have a 2004 land rover discovery and it's running ruff at idle. I have 90k on the truck I did the head gasket overhaul and ran great for 20k then this started happening. My check engine light does not come on but I read my codes anyway and found I had major misfire and o2 sensor bank 1 problems and a few ride along codes. First I thought CKP sensor, thats new and stilll nothing. Then I thought wires and replaced them and still misfires turned out I had bad wires. So I changed the wires and plugs. Magnecor 8.5 and bosch +4. I had the fuel pressure checked turned out injector 7 was clogged, replaced that fuel pressure fine. still running ruff oh and I run 93 oct in the truck. Idle sensor is fine aswell. Maf sensor in new. And today I checked my codes again and now I have cylinder 1, 3, 5, 7, and 6 misfiring the codes come up twice. and also the o2 sensors thats next on the list to change but that shouldn't cause the engine to misfire or am I wrong. Also someone told me this might be the Camshaft sensor but I'm not sure. Oh and I checked the fuses and relays and everything checks out fine no blown fuses or burnt smell. hey guys just want to update you all on my truck I got the ignition coil packs yesterday and I just finished changing them and started it right up and she's running nice except for I think I might have a very small exhaust leak or its just those stupid O2 sensors which im going right now to get my truck scanned and see if they are still acting up.
